I've got 16 6 1/2's in my 240, on 600 watts. They are custom made for me...11mm of Xmax, FS of 32hz. Just messing around, we did a 134 db on music, and they play plenty low. Haven't really got around to tuning it yet, so there's more in there...

I've done 2 JL 6's in cars before and it sounds surprisingly good....about the same as a decent single 10. Done a couple trucks with 4 JL 6's and you'd swear it was a pair of 10's or even 12's.
